Sensory Marketing can be described as a type of marketing which makes use of techniques that appeals to all the customer's senses and influence their behavior in relation to the brand. It makes use of the senses (sight, hearing, taste, touch and smell) to relate with the customers on an emotional level in order to help inspire the right mood and drive sales.

Strategies used by the ego to help reduce the anxiety caused by too much conflict between the id and superego are called "<span>defense mechanisms".
Defense mechanisms refers to psychological strategies that are unknowingly used to shield a man from nervousness emerging from inadmissible considerations or emotions. We utilize defense mechanisms to shield ourselves from sentiments of nervousness or blame, which emerge on the grounds that we feel undermined, or on the grounds that our id or superego turns out to be excessively requesting.
